Ukraine Bolsters Domestic Arms Production with DESNA Vehicle
Ukraine’s defense industry is actively expanding its capabilities with the introduction of the DESNA, a new 4×4 tactical armored vehicle developed by UkrArmoTech. The vehicle is designed to address the Ukrainian military’s increasing demand for high-mobility, multi-purpose armored platforms, notably those that can be manufactured and maintained domestically. This development comes as Ukrainian forces continue to engage in sustained combat operations and rely on a diverse range of armored vehicles supplied by international partners.
UkrArmoTech describes the DESNA as an adaptable, multi-role vehicle capable of supporting a variety of missions. These include troop transport, logistics support, reconnaissance operations, command and control functions, and integration with remote weapon stations. The vehicle’s design prioritizes crew survivability, simplified maintenance procedures, and compatibility with existing Ukrainian production lines, streamlining logistics and reducing reliance on external supply chains.
Key Features and Design Ideology
The DESNA’s design emphasizes modularity, allowing for rapid configuration changes to suit different mission requirements. UkrArmoTech highlights the vehicle’s optimized weight distribution and the use of components already present in their other serially produced vehicles, suggesting a focus on cost-effectiveness and ease of repair.This approach aims to minimize logistical challenges and maximize operational readiness in the field.
The development of the DESNA reflects a broader shift in Ukrainian military strategy towards more mobile, dispersed, and protected operations. This necessitates vehicles that can provide enhanced crew protection while maintaining agility and adaptability in dynamic combat environments. The emphasis on domestic production also underscores Ukraine’s commitment to strengthening its defense industrial base and reducing its dependence on foreign arms suppliers, particularly during wartime.
The Broader Context of Ukrainian Armored Vehicle Needs
While Ukraine has received ample armored vehicle support from international partners – including Mine-Resistant Ambush Protected (MRAP) vehicles, light tactical trucks, and specialized engineering platforms – the need for locally manufactured options remains critical. Sustained combat operations have created a consistent demand for vehicles that can be quickly replaced and maintained without relying on complex international supply chains. The DESNA is positioned to fill this gap.
Ukraine’s defense industry has faced notable challenges since the start of the full-scale invasion in February 2022, but has also demonstrated remarkable resilience and innovation. The development of the DESNA is a testament to this capability, showcasing Ukraine’s ability to design and produce advanced military equipment despite ongoing hostilities. The success of this project could pave the way for further expansion of Ukraine’s domestic arms production capacity.
future Prospects and Production Timeline
ukrarmotech anticipates that the DESNA will enter full-scale production if it successfully completes ongoing trials. The company views the vehicle as a key component of ukraine’s long-term strategy to bolster its defense industrial base and enhance its self-sufficiency in military equipment. The timeline for full-scale production remains dependent on the outcome of these trials and the availability of necessary resources.
